BECOMING A PARISHIONER

 

Blessed Sacrament welcomes new parishioners!  Please join us as we live out our mission:

We are a faith community of believers called to celebrate the real presence of Jesus Christ in the Holy Eucharist and joyfully proclaim the word of God. We journey in God's love.

 

For those moving into the area or transferring from another parish in town, we ask that you register with the parish by:

U    filling out a registration form after any of the Masses the first weekend of the month.  One of the Greeters at Mass will be available in the Reconciliation Room in the back of church with registration cards and information about Blessed Sacrament.

U    Or, stopping by or calling the Parish Office during the week (8 a.m.-4 p.m.)

A member of our Welcoming Committee will be in touch to follow up on your initial registration and answer any further questions you may have.

 

For those who are not Catholic and have an interest in becoming part of our faith community:

Our Catholic faith tradition provides a formation process, called the Rite of Christian Initiation of Adults , to prepare people to become Catholic.  Whether you have never been baptized or were baptized in another faith tradition, there is a place in the process for you to prepare for initiation into the Catholic Christian community.  We provide formation in Scripture, worship, prayer, and community through weekly sessions and involvement in the life of the parish.  If you are a family with children, preparation is available for them as well.  Call (222-2759) or e-mail (agage1948@yahoo.com ) Ann Gage to learn more about the process.
